CENTERSTAGE to Reconfigure The Head Theater
By: Gabrielle Sierra
After the close of The Second City: Charmed & Dangerous, CENERSTAGE's Head Theater will undergo a face lift.
"One of the things I loved when I first came to this theater was the uniqueness and wonderful flexibility of The Head Theater," says Artistic Director Kwame Kwei-Armah. "Since taking over, however, it has come to my attention that The Head Theater receives many complaints from patrons, designers, and directors. Bearing in mind that I share their concerns, we are reconfiguring The Head Theater to a more ‘traditional' space. This, however, is not the destinations-it is a stop on the road to a fully flexible 21st-Century theatrical black box."With a goal of returning to a space more seriously dedicated to the art, Cabaret tables will be whisked away and more traditional seating will be installed to return the space to a more theatrical venue for the remainder of the 2011-12 Season.All patrons seats will be in comparable locations to their current seats, and patrons who have already received their tickets for Head Theater shows will not need new tickets. The reconfiguration will also open up the more than 25 additional seats in the space.For more info visit: http://www.centerstage.org/
